Hello everyone. I'm looking for some help with a problem I'm having with a 1997 Olds 88 I picked up for my sis. It's not a 60 degree, but I think it's a transmission problem. She was driving on the highway today and she got a check engine light and the car began to give trouble accelerating. She said everything felt fine but it would only pick up speed very gradually and would take forever to hit 60 mph's. The RPM's aren't jumping or anything. Had it scanned at Autozone and got a code P1870 for transmission slippage or something like that. The way she's describing it to me it kind of sounds like she got stuck in 4th gear. The next day it drove fine. I myself drove this car over 400 miles before I gave it to her and I had no problems, but I did notice an occasional very slight harsh shift from either 2nd to 3rd or 3rd to 4th, I'm not sure which. Is there any chance this could be an easy fix like the transmission modulator or something? Thanks everyone for reading.
